#c78d1e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c78d1e is composed of 78% red, 55.3%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.1% magenta, 84.9%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 39.4 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 44.9%. #c78d1e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ff3c with #8f1b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#c78d1e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0802 is the darkest color, while #fefd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c78d1e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78746d is the less saturated color, while #e19504 is the most saturated one.
